About this Role:


This position should be viewed as learning and training position with increasing responsibilities as the trainee advances. the Safety Manager Trainees (SMT) are expected to develop leadership, safety management and organizational skills while performing a variety of assigned job functions within a manufacturing facility. The SMT will have a mentoring relationship with a key staff member, will attend a variety of training courses to develop both technical and soft skills, and will be expected to rotate through various departments of the facility to develop experience and knowledge of the process and industry. The trainee will be exposed to regulatory agencies such as MSHA, OSHA, ATF, State agencies, and could include DOT and FRA.

What to expect in a cement environment
:


Work to be performed in a shop environment as well as outdoor exposure throughout the plant. Mild exposure to cement dust, heat, cold, and noise requires compliance with specified safety guidelines and procedures. Exposure to high elevations of up to 250 feet in height. Exposure to all weather conditions. Normal operation of mobile equipment may result in jarring and vibratory exposure. Regulatory inspections and other activities may require extra work hours.
